Increasing Healthcare Demand and Market Expansion
The Philippines wound electrical stimulation devices market is experiencing steady growth, driven by rising healthcare awareness, an increasing prevalence of chronic wounds, and a growing elderly population. As non-healing wounds become a significant medical challenge, healthcare providers are actively seeking advanced wound care solutions. Electrical stimulation therapy is gaining acceptance as an effective treatment for accelerating wound healing, particularly for diabetic ulcers, pressure injuries, and surgical wounds.
The market is expanding as hospitals, specialty clinics, and home healthcare services incorporate advanced medical technologies to improve patient outcomes. Government initiatives aimed at enhancing healthcare infrastructure and expanding access to modern treatments further contribute to market growth. Factors Driving Market Growth and Consumer Trends
The increasing incidence of diabetes and vascular diseases in the Philippines is a major driver of demand for wound electrical stimulation devices. Many patients suffering from chronic wounds require long-term care, leading to a heightened need for advanced treatment options. Additionally, the country’s aging population contributes to market expansion, as elderly individuals often experience delayed wound healing and require specialized care solutions.
Growing awareness of modern wound management techniques is shifting consumer preferences from traditional healing methods to technologically advanced solutions. The introduction of cost-effective and easy-to-use electrical stimulation devices is further encouraging adoption among both healthcare providers and individual consumers. With increasing investments in research and development, the market is expected to see further innovation, making these devices even more effective and accessible.
Competitive Environment and Industry Challenges
The Philippines wound electrical stimulation devices market is competitive, with global medical technology firms and local manufacturers striving to capture market share. International companies are bringing cutting-edge technologies to the country, while domestic manufacturers focus on affordability and compliance with regulatory requirements. Businesses that can offer high-quality products at competitive prices will have a strong advantage in the evolving market landscape.
However, challenges such as limited awareness, high initial costs, and regulatory hurdles may affect market growth. To overcome these barriers, companies need to invest in education and training programs for healthcare professionals, develop strategic pricing models, and engage in targeted marketing efforts. Strengthening partnerships with hospitals and medical associations can also help in increasing product adoption and market expansion.
